The Flange Fit Foundation: Why Size Is Everything

Imagine trying to run a marathon in shoes three sizes too big. No matter the quality of the sneakers, the experience would be painful, inefficient, and likely injurious. The same principle applies to breast pump flanges. The flange, or breast shield, is the funnel-shaped piece that connects directly to your breast. Its primary function is to create a secure seal and a tunnel through which your nipple can move freely without friction, stimulating the milk ducts and allowing milk to flow into the collection bottle. When the flange is too large, it pulls an excessive amount of the areola and breast tissue into the tunnel. This can compress milk ducts, cause significant pain and swelling, and drastically reduce milk output because the pump is not effectively stimulating the nipple. Conversely, a flange that is too small causes its own set of problems, including nipple compression, rubbing, and blanching. The "goldilocks" fit—one that is just right—is non-negotiable for a positive pumping experience.

Breaking the Standard Size Myth

For years, many pump manufacturers included only 24mm and 27mm flanges in their standard kits, occasionally offering a 21mm as the "small" option. This sizing paradigm was built on an outdated and inaccurate average. The truth is, nipple size is as diverse as shoe size or height. A substantial number of lactating parents have nipples that measure significantly smaller than 21mm in diameter, especially after pumping, when the nipple should be at its most elongated. This population has been historically underserved, forced to endure painful sessions or resort to DIY modifications. Recognizing that a need for flanges smaller than 21mm is not an anomaly but a common reality is the first step toward inclusive and effective lactation support. It affirms that seeking a proper fit is not being difficult; it is being proactive about your breastfeeding journey.

How to Accurately Measure Your Nipple for a Perfect Fit

Finding your ideal flange size requires a simple but precise measurement. Do not measure your nipple while it is at rest. Instead, the most accurate measurement is taken after a pumping session or after gently stimulating the nipple to mimic a let-down, when the nipple is at its fullest elongation.

  1. Gather Your Tools: You will need a ruler or a printable nipple sizing ruler with clear millimeter markings. Avoid using a flexible sewing tape measure as it can be inaccurate for small, firm diameters.
  2. Stimulate and Pump: Either use your pump for a minute or two (without the collection bottle attached to observe) or use hand expression to encourage a let-down and nipple elongation.
  3. Measure the Diameter: Using the ruler, measure the diameter of your nipple at its widest point. Do not include the areola. Measure just the nipple itself. This number, in millimeters, is your starting point for flange size.
  4. Calculate Your Flange Size: The general rule is to add 0-4mm to your nipple diameter. For very elastic tissue that stretches a lot, you may only need to add 0-2mm. For less elastic tissue, adding 2-4mm is more appropriate. For example, if your nipple measures 17mm, your ideal flange size is likely between 17mm and 21mm. This is where sub-21mm sizes become crucial.

It is highly recommended to consult with an International Board Certified Lactation Consultant (IBCLC) who can assist with this process and provide professional guidance.

The Telltale Signs Your Flange is Too Big

How do you know if you might need a flange smaller than 21mm? Your body will send you clear signals, often interpreted as general pumping problems rather than a simple sizing issue. Key indicators include:

  • Pain During and After Pumping: Aching, pinching, or burning sensations are not normal. Pumping should be comfortable, not painful.
  • Excessive Areola Pull-In: If you see a large portion of your areola being pulled deep into the tunnel of the flange, the size is too large.
  • Low Milk Output: Despite long pumping sessions and a good supply, you struggle to express a sufficient volume of milk.
  • Nipple Swelling and Discoloration: The nipple or areola may appear swollen, red, or bruised after pumping.
  • Blanching: Parts of the nipple turn white due to restricted blood flow.
  • Unemptied Breasts: Your breasts still feel full or lumpy after a pumping session, indicating inefficient milk removal.

Ignoring these signs can lead to more serious issues like damaged breast tissue, clogged ducts, and even mastitis, underscoring the urgency of finding a correct fit.

The World of Sub-21mm Flanges: Sizes and Solutions

Thankfully, increased awareness has driven demand, and the market now offers a wider array of options for those needing smaller flanges. While not always available on store shelves, these specialty sizes can be found through various channels. Common sizes now include 19mm, 17mm, 15mm, and even 13mm and 11mm in some lines. These are often sold as individual accessories or in "fit packs" that contain a range of smaller sizes. It's important to note that flange sizing is not universally standardized. A 17mm flange from one brand might have a slightly different internal diameter or tunnel shape than a 17mm from another. This means finding your perfect fit might require some trial and error, even within the sub-21mm category. Some companies also offer silicone flanges, which can provide a softer, more flexible seal and may fit differently than traditional hard plastic versions.

Beyond the Pump: The Impact of a Proper Fit

The benefits of switching to a correctly sized, smaller flange extend far beyond immediate comfort. It is a transformative change for many pumping journeys.

  • Maximized Milk Production: Efficient nipple stimulation leads to more effective let-downs and better drainage of the breast, which signals your body to produce more milk. This can be a game-changer for establishing and maintaining supply.
  • Pain-Free Sessions: Eliminating pain reduces stress and makes the entire process more manageable and sustainable, especially for those who need to pump exclusively or multiple times a day.
  • Protection of Breast Health: Proper fit prevents the tissue damage that leads to chronic issues like vasospasm, persistent clogs, and inflammation.
  • Empowerment and Confidence: Solving a fundamental problem empowers parents to continue their breastfeeding goals. It turns a source of frustration into a successful part of their routine.

Navigating Challenges and Finding Support

Acquiring these smaller flanges can sometimes present hurdles. They can be harder to find and may represent an additional expense on top of an already costly pump. However, framing it as a necessary investment in both your mental and physical health is crucial. Seek out online communities and forums dedicated to breastfeeding and pumping. These spaces are invaluable resources where parents share specific brand recommendations, links to retailers, and firsthand experiences with different smaller flange options. Furthermore, a prescription for flanges from a doctor or IBCLC may allow you to seek reimbursement through your health insurance or a Health Savings Account (HSA/FSA), as they are considered medical devices.
